Transaction 28ad66dc767680a03c669ac911524fa128b5ecf875b38f9d22ca74d3328df60b
1 Input
1 Output
-
28ad66dc767680a03c669ac911524fa128b5ecf875b38f9d22ca74d3328df60b:0
- value
- 118202664
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f73ec3f55bd087d5b131ee7d5fb99f2ae5a00e1e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PYK6QNPidtqjoWM1C5ShVh85843jfkAK6